Milo Summary
Milo is a town located in Piscataquis County, Maine, United States. The population was 2,345 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Bangor, Maine metropolitan statistical area.
Geography
Milo is located at 44°37′N 69°2′W (44.619, -69.033). According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 35.2sqmi, of which, 34.7sqmi of it is land and 0.5sqmi of it (1.37%) is water.
History
Milo was first settled in 1812 by settlers from Massachusetts. It was incorporated as a town on March 6, 1820. The town was named after Milo, the son of Hercules in Greek mythology.
The town was originally a farming community, but in the late 19th century, it became a center for the lumber industry. The town was also home to several granite quarries, which provided stone for many of the buildings in the area.
Economy
Milo is a rural town with a population of 2,345 people. The town is home to several small businesses, including a lumber mill, a granite quarry, and a few small retail stores. The town also has a few restaurants and a few small manufacturing businesses.
The town is also home to a few small farms, which produce a variety of crops, including potatoes, corn, and hay. The town also has a few small apple orchards, which produce apples for local consumption.
Demographics
As of the census of 2010, there were 2,345 people, 945 households, and 645 families residing in the town. The population density was 67.3 people per square mile (25.9/km2). There were 1,039 housing units at an average density of 29.9 per square mile (11.6/km2). The racial makeup of the town was 97.2% White, 0.3% African American, 0.3% Native American, 0.2% Asian, 0.1% Pacific Islander, 0.3% from other races, and 1.6%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.9% of the population.
There were 945 households, out of which 28.2%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 51.2% were married couples living together, 10.7% had a female householder with no husband present, and 33.2% were non-families. 28.2% of all households were made up of individuals, and 13.2%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.41 and the average family size was 2.91.
In the town, the population was spread out, with 23.2% under the age of 18, 6.7% from 18 to 24, 25.2% from 25 to 44, 28.2% from 45 to 64, and 16.7%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 41 years. For every 100 females, there were 95.2 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 92.2 males.
The median income for a household in the town was $30,938, and the median income for a family was $37,917. Males had a median income of $30,000 versus $21,250 for females. The per capita income for the town was $15,945. About 11.2% of families and 14.2% of the population were below the poverty line, including 19.2% of those under age 18 and 10.2% of those age 65 or over.
